ORDER signed by Magistrate Judge Kendall J. Newman on 7/18/2014 GRANTING defendants' 35 motion to modify; defendants shall file their motion for summary judgment for failure to exhaust within 30 days; discovery is STAYED until defendants' motion for summary judgment for failure to exhaust is resolved; and 30 days after the district court rules on defendants' motion for summary judgment for failure to exhaust, the parties may serve discovery requests, if appropriate.
